Their gross income from grants, donations and service provision is around $15.5 million dollars each year. In the year ended 30 June 2014, that income included government grants of $11.7 million.
Alarmingly Family Planning is pleased with the “success” of their Tauranga abortion facility. According to their Annual Report 138 women had abortions in the year under review (1 July 2013 to 30 June 2014).
At this clinic Family Planning have been providing early medical abortions since March 2013. Women are given the drug mifepristone (which blocks the action of the pregnancy hormone progesterone) then some time later (up to 48 hours) another drug, misoprostol, will be administered, expelling the preborn child and pregnancy related tissue.
